Product reviews:
Saxon
2026-01-03 iphone 7 Plus
2019 Mountain Bike World Cup Schedule uci mountain bike calendar
uci mountain bike calendar
Horace
2026-01-10 iphone 7
USA Cycling Announces 2020 Mountain uci mountain bike calendar
uci mountain bike calendar
2020 Canadian national mountain bike uci mountain bike calendar
uci mountain bike calendar
USA Cycling announces 2019 and 2020 uci mountain bike calendar
uci mountain bike calendar